Output 669352c3c85deb3fbcd8c1cc182842960d7530f00c2427999286f9ac1f9db1ca:0

value
18697319
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d999ac8bc8be4baeb0bfea4547adbc1db30ad01 OP_EQUALVERIFY OP_CHECKSIG
address
19XurUefJiqH325j1J413Dt1DRWMqAxz1C
transaction
669352c3c85deb3fbcd8c1cc182842960d7530f00c2427999286f9ac1f9db1ca
spent
true